{% for item in list.searchHits %} {% set locationdId = item.valueObject.versionInfo.contentInfo.mainLocationId %} {% set active = false %} {% if locationdId in locations %} {% set active = true %} {% endif %} {% set dropdown = false %} {% set css_classes = 'topmenu-item' %} {% set extra_attributes = '' %} {% if location_children[locationdId] is defined %} {% set dropdown = true %} {% set css_classes = css_classes ~ ' dropdown' %} {% endif %} {% if active %} {% set css_classes = css_classes ~ ' active' %} {% endif %}
  • {{ render( controller( 'ez_content:viewLocation', { 'locationId': item.valueObject.versionInfo.contentInfo.mainLocationId, 'viewType': 'menu_item', 'params': { 'active':active, 'dropdown' : dropdown } } ) ) }} {% if location_children[locationdId] is defined %}
      {% for subitem in location_children[locationdId].searchHits %}
    • {{ render( controller( 'ez_content:viewLocation', { 'locationId': subitem.valueObject.versionInfo.contentInfo.mainLocationId, 'viewType': 'menu_item', 'params': {} } ) ) }}
    • {% endfor %}
    {% endif %}
  • {% endfor %}